Our mission

In full partnership with families and communities, Graham Windham strives to make a life-altering difference with children, youth and families who are overcoming some of life's most difficult challenges and obstacles, by helping to build a strong foundation for life: a safe, loving, permanent family and the opportunity and preparation to thrive in school and in the world.

What we do

Eliza Hamilton established Graham Windham as the first private orphanage in New York City in honor of her husband, Alexander Hamilton. Over 200 years later, Graham Windham's mission to support kids and families lives on. Today, Graham serves thousands of kids and their families. Most of these kids have had a tough start in life. But through their own strength and Graham's support -- whether through family counseling and treatment, or after school academic help, these kids can thrive into adulthood. Eliza's dream was to give every kid to get their shot -- that mission lives on today. #ElizasStory
